Does the Driveway Patrol Work to Deter Intruders?

Let’s face it, in today’s world we could all use a little more home security.  This thought led to the creation of the Driveway Patrol wireless alert system.  Typically sold via TV infomercials, this system is comprised of a sensor that you place in your driveway and a receiver that you keep in your home.  The purpose of the Driveway Patrol is to let you know when someone is coming into your yard or driveway.

 

Positive Reviews

 

The reviews on the Driveway Patrol are fairly mixed.  A number of people love the device and the convenience it offers them in letting them know when the cat wants in or when the mailman has arrived.  Very few of the raves have actually been about enhanced security, leading many to wonder if, at a minimum, the Driveway Patrol is being mismarketed.

 

Negative Reviews

 

The negative reviews of the device are fairly concerning.  Many people report dozens of false alarms each day, which has led to customers returning the device.  The company says that putting tape over the sensor to stop it being so sensitive may help, but it seems that this offers limited results.  Many also complain that the alarm included in the device is too loud, rarely works when needed, and often fails completely for no reason. 

Ultimately, the Driveway Patrol may well be a device that had a great concept, which translated poorly into the actual product.  That much said, you get what you pay for.  While the Driveway Patrol isn’t the best infomercial device of the decade, it is certainly far from the worst.
